LaRose Industries recalls Snoopy Sno-Cone Machines with specific batch numbers due to a brass rivet falling into sno-cones and causing mouth or tooth injury. Consumers must stop using immediately and get a free repair kit.

Check for batch numbers BCH003005A28-081: BCHTRU001A17-0812, or BCHTRU004A16-0712 printed on the back of the white plastic doghouse or the side of the box. The machines are white with a red roof and shovel, featuring Snoopy and Charlie Brown/Lucy images.

Consumers should stop using the recalled sno-cone machines immediately and contact LaRose Industries for a free repair kit, which includes a new ice shaving cylinder. Do not return the recalled sno-cone machines to the store where purchased.
